Overall Meaning

The song "Once Upon a Drive-By" by Ganxta are?dd (pronounced Gansta Ared) is a gritty depiction of drive-by shootings and gang violence in Los Angeles. The song is introduced with a depiction of a group of friends together on a cold night, carrying weapons and waiting for instructions from the Godfather (presumably the leader of their gang). The verses are a stream of consciousness account of a drive-by shooting, with the singer (presumably one of the gang members) describing the violence in graphic detail. The chorus, which is sung by a different voice (Godfather Rock TE), emphasizes the recklessness of the violence and the sense of impending doom that accompanies it. The last verse rhapsodizes the violence as unstoppable, and portrays the gang members as soldiers on a mission.
